Directorios (reporte grafico)

Linux tiene su propia distribución de archivos y carpetas, lo que puede causar confusión a los usuarios que utilizan Windows porque es diferente. En Linux, hay un principio que sigue como una filosofía: todo es un archivo: los accesos directos (atajos), dispositivos físicos como un mouse o teclado, discos duros, carpetas, etc.

Mientras que, en Windows, una ruta normal de carpetas podría ser C:\Users\Zaira, una ruta equivalente en un sistema operativo Linux sería /home/Zaira:

 

1. Directorio home: Es la carpeta que pertenece al usuario y, por lo tanto, el destinado a almacenar todos los archivos del usuario, como documentos, fotos, vídeos, música, etc.

2. ¿En qué carpeta (directorio) estoy?

En la terminal de Linux, normalmente la carpeta (o parte de ella) en la que nos encontramos se muestra a la izquierda. Sin embargo, dependiendo de nuestra configuración de Shell (programa que gestiona los comandos que introduce el usuario), es posible que no aparezca. Si queremos saber en qué carpeta estamos, podemos usar el comando pwd (print work directory).


3. ¿Cómo crear un directorio?

Para crear un nuevo directorio en Linux, debemos pasar su nombre como parámetro al comando mkdir. En nuestra ubicación actual, su uso es muy sencillo:


4. ¿Cómo crear varios directorios a la vez?

Podemos usar el comando mkdir para crear múltiples directorios al mismo tiempo. podemos crearlos anidados unos dentro de otros de la siguiente forma con el parámetro -p


5. ¿Cómo crear varios directorios con espacios?

Igual utilizamos el comando mkdir. Para crearlos al mismo nivel solo tenemos que separarlos por espacios.



6. Remover un directorio

rmdir es el comando de Linux para eliminar directorios vacíos. Es útil cuando se desea eliminar un directorio sólo si está vacío.

7. Crear directorio en ruta absoluta

Si lo que queremos es crear un fichero en otra ubicación, por ejemplo, en /tmp, desde cualquier ubicación, lo haríamos así: mkdir/tmp/prueba


8. Cambiar de directorios

Para navegar por la estructura del sistema de archivos, se utiliza el comando cd (change directory) para cambiar directorios.


9. Borrar directorio con rm -R nombre

Para eliminar un directorio con todo su contenido (carpetas y archivos) usamos la opción -r o -R (recursivo).


10. Borrar directorio con rm -Rf nombre

Si algún directorio o archivo está protegido contra escritura nos pedirá confirmación para borrarlo. Para forzar y eliminar todos los archivos y directorios de manera recursiva de un directorio usamos la opción -r y -f:


Los comandos de Linux permiten llevar a cabo operaciones en los directorios del sistema que son muy útiles. Cada uno de estos comandos utilizados nos permiten saber su utilización empleándolos y de esa forma poder comprobar que sus características están siendo utilizadas correctamente en nuestra línea de comando.




Referencias: 

Kerrisk, M. (8 de Mayo de 2020). Acerca de nosotros: A. Digital Guide IONOS. Recuperado el 14 de Marzo de 2021, de Digital Guide IONOS Web site: https://www.ionos.mx/digitalguide/servidores/configuracion/comandos-de-linux-la-lista-fundamental/ 

Comentarios